45edo’s approximations of 3/1, 5/1, 7/1, 11/1, 13/1 and 17/1 are all improved by [[Gallery of arithmetic pitch sequences#APS of farabs|APS3.21farab]], a [[Octave stretch|stretched-octave]] version of 45edo. The trade-off is a slightly worse 2/1.


The tuning [[ed257/128#45ed257/128|45ed257/128]] may be used for this purpose too, it improves 3/1, 5/1, 11/1 and 13/1, at the cost of a slightly worse 2/1 and 7/1.
